[edit] Definition
INT resume_song ( )
Resumes a song, after it has been paused with the function pause_song().
[edit] Returns
INT : Error.
| -1 | - Error: sound inactive. | 
| 0 | - No error. | 
[edit] Notes
The song will instantly start playing again with this function. For a nicer effect, you may want to fade the music in as you resume it. See fade_music_in().
[edit] Example
program music_example;
global
    my_song;
    playing;
    paused;
    faded_in;
    v;
begin
    set_mode(640,480,16);
    
    my_song=load_song("beat.ogg");
    
    
    write(0,320,30,4,"Use the keyboard to control the music playback.");
    write(0,320,50,4,"Key [ENTER] starts / stops the song.");
    write(0,320,60,4,"Key [SPACE] pauses / resumes the song.");
    write(0,320,70,4,"Key [0] through key [9] changes the song volume.");
    write(0,320,80,4,"Key [F] fades the song in or out.");
    
    write(0,320,120,5,"Playing: ");
    write_int(0,320,120,3,&playing);
    
    write(0,320,140,5,"Paused: ");
    write_int(0,320,140,3,&paused);
    
    write(0,320,160,5,"Faded in: ");
    write_int(0,320,160,3,&faded_in);
    
    write(0,320,180,5,"Volume: ");
    write_int(0,320,180,3,&v);
    
    v=128;
    faded_in=true;
    repeat
        if(key(_enter))
            if(is_playing_song())
                stop_song();
                playing=false;
            else
                play_song(my_song,1);
                playing=true;
            end
            while(key(_enter))frame;end
        end
        
        if(key(_space))
            if(paused)
                paused=false;
                resume_song();
            else
                paused=true;
                pause_song();
            end
            while(key(_space))frame;end
        end
        
        if(key(_f))
            if(faded_in)
                faded_in=false;
                fade_music_off(100);
            else
                faded_in=true;
                fade_music_in(my_song,1,100);
            end
            while(key(_f))frame;end
        end
        
        if(key(_0))v=0;end
        if(key(_1))v=14;end
        if(key(_2))v=28;end
        if(key(_3))v=43;end
        if(key(_4))v=57;end
        if(key(_5))v=71;end
        if(key(_6))v=85;end
        if(key(_7))v=100;end
        if(key(_8))v=114;end
        if(key(_9))v=128;end
        
        set_song_volume(v);
    frame;
    until(key(_esc))
    
    exit();
end
Used in example: key(), set_mode(), load_song(), write(), write_int(), pause_song(), play_song(), stop_song(), resume_song(), fade_music_in(), fade_music_off(), set_song_volume().
